0 reports about 8573670063The number was first reported 25th Jun, 2025
Received a phone call from 8573670063? Report here
File a report about 8573670063 |
Phone Number Variations: 8573670063, 08573-670063, 918573670063, 008573670063, 1918573670063, +1918573670063